If the equation whose roots are \(p\) times the roots of \(x^4-2 a x^3+4 b x^2+8 a x+16=0\) is a reciprocal equation, then \(|p|=\)
- A 3
- B 2
- C \(\frac{1}{2}\)
- D \(\frac{1}{3}\)
Answer & Solution
Correct Answer
(C) \(\frac{1}{2}\)
Step-by-step Solution
Detailed explanation
Let the roots are \(\alpha, \beta, \gamma, \delta\) for the equation \[ x^4-2 a x^3+4 b x^2+8 a x+16=0 ...(i) \] So, \[ \alpha \times \beta \times \gamma \times \delta=16 \] For the reciprocal equation roots are \(p \alpha, p \beta, p \gamma\) and \(p \delta\), so product of…
